import React from 'react';
import { motion } from 'motion/react';
import { UserData } from '../App';
import { Check, Star, MessageCircle, Sparkles } from 'lucide-react';
interface TariffSelectionProps {
userData: UserData;
}
export function TariffSelection({ userData }: TariffSelectionProps) {
const getRecommendedTariff = () => {
const { currentIncome, hasBlog } = userData;
if (currentIncome.includes('0') || hasBlog === 'no') {
return 'basic';
} else if (currentIncome.includes('2000') || currentIncome.includes('5000')) {
return 'premium';
} else {
return 'basic';
}
};
const recommendedTariff = getRecommendedTariff();
const tariffs = [
{
id: 'basic',
name: 'Базовый',
price: '680€',
subtitle: 'Для старта с нуля',
description: 'Если доход до 1000€ — больше самостоятельной работы',
features: [
'Полная программа курса 2,5 месяца',
'Доступ к закрытому Telegram-каналу',
'Все материалы, шаблоны и чек-листы',
'Помощь в чате при возникновении вопросов',
'Пошаговая система внедрения',
'Доступ к урокам навсегда',
],
cta: 'Оставить заявку',
highlighted: false,
},
{
id: 'premium',
name: 'Премиум',
price: '980€',
subtitle: 'Для роста и масштабирования',
description: 'Если уже есть клиенты/блог — разборы, докрутка, ускорение',
features: [
'Всё из базового тарифа',
'Персональные разборы вашей ниши',
'Анализ вашего контента и продукта',
'Индивидуальная стратегия под вас',
'Приоритетная поддержка в чате',
'Еженедельные групповые созвоны',
'Личная обратная связь от меня',
],
cta: 'Оставить заявку',
highlighted: true,
},
];
const handleTelegramClick = () => {
// In production, this would open Telegram with pre-filled message
const message = encodeURIComponent(
`Привет! Меня зовут ${userData.name}. Прошёл диагностику на сайте.\n` +
`Моя ниша: ${userData.niche}\n` +
`Текущий доход: ${userData.currentIncome}\n` +
`Хочу узнать бо��ьше о курсе «Чит-код».`
);
window.open(`https://t.me/${userData.telegram}?text=${message}`, '_blank');
};
return (
{/* Header */}
Выбор тарифа
Курс «Чит-код» по маркетингу
{userData.name}, с учётом вашей цели и точки старта мы рекомендуем вам формат{' '}
{recommendedTariff === 'premium' ? 'Премиум' : 'Базовый'}
{/* About Course */}
О программе
Это не «про мотивацию», а про деньги и систему.
За 2,5 месяца вы освоите все необходимые навыки для заработка в онлайне.
Вы научитесь: создавать вирусный контент, упаковывать продукты, настраивать воронки,
запускать рекламу, автоматизировать процессы и продавать системно.
Программа включает: съёмку и монтаж экспертных рилс, создание визуала,
структуру продающих лендингов, сторителлинги, прогревы, триггеры продаж,
автоматизацию с помощью ботов, таргетированную рекламу.
Каждый модуль — это конкретный навык, который приносит деньги,
а не теория.
Вы можете взять меньший тариф, но тогда{' '}
персональные разборы и стратегия останутся на вас.
Если хотите ускорить результат и получить индивидуальный подход — выбирайте Премиум.